At first we find in the heart of the ASUS Rog Ally a six-core AMD Ryzen Z1 chip and an RDNA 3 graphics chip, which uses AMD’s Super Resolution FidelityFX and Super Resolution scaling technologies. Just there, in terms of powerful brute, we are well in front of a Steam Deck. Besides, people who have had the opportunity to test it are already announcing 50% more power compared to the Steam Deck. It’s enormous as it is for equal consumption. A real tour de force from the Taiwanese manufacturer. ASUS is already promising Cyberpunk 2077 in good conditions at 60 FPS. Sign of his omnipotence.

For display, the ROG Ally has a screen Full HD 120 Hz (alas without OLED) seven-inch capable of displaying up to 500 Nits of brightness with a response time of 7 ms. ASUS wanted to favor the reactivated (120 Hz) since there is currently no 7-inch OLED panel. To accompany the GPU and CPU there is 16 GB of LPDDR5 RAM. Not bad is not it ? The Rog Ally also announces support for Dolby Atmos via the speakers to have audio that matches the rendering of the screen. The whole package has a total weight of only 608 g.

As for storage, the ROG Ally will come with un SSD de 512 Go, which can be further expanded with a microSD card. For the rest of the proposals, while the Steam Deck uses its own SteamOS as the default operating system, the ROG Ally will allow users to access games from a wide variety of PC platforms because it works on windows 11. You should be able to use all of your PC accessories, including controllers, headphones, mice, and keyboards. Great news.

Finally, the console uses a custom-designed cooling system, which Asus says is quiet and barely noticeable when using the ROG Ally speakers. We know ASUS on the very serious subject of cooling and it’s hard to have any doubts on this side.

The Rog Ally: the summary of its technical characteristics

In summary, we find:

  • Screen : 7 inch 1080p 120Hz touch screen and 7ms response time with FreeSync
  • Weight : 608 g
  • Processor : AMD Ryzen Z1 series
  • GPU (graphics) : RDNA 3
  • Storage : SSD PCI Express 4.0 de 512 Go
  • RAM : 16 Go to RAM
  • MicroSD slot for storage expansion
  • WiFi 6E
  • Windows 11 operating system
  • Haptic feedback
  • Fingerprint sensor for unlocking

ASUS ROG Ally, what price?

Regarding the price, Asus has not yet confirmed the sale price of the ROG Ally, but the company has guaranteed that it will not exceed $1000. We hope it will be the same story in euros. The Steam Deck is offered to him at 679 euros in its most expensive version.
